VMware作为虚拟化技术的佼佼者,被广泛应用于各种场景,如服务器整合、测试环境搭建、应用部署等
然而,在实际应用中,有时会遇到真机(即物理机)无法访问VMware网络的问题,这不仅影响了工作效率,还可能对业务运行造成潜在风险
本文将从多个角度剖析这一问题,并提供一系列切实可行的解决方案
一、问题背景与影响 真机无法访问VMware网络的问题,通常表现为物理机与运行在VMware上的虚拟机(VM)之间无法进行网络通信
这种故障可能由多种原因引起,包括但不限于网络配置错误、防火墙设置不当、路由问题、VMware工具安装缺失等
一旦问题发生,将直接影响数据同步、远程管理、应用访问等关键业务操作,严重时甚至可能导致服务中断
二、问题剖析 2.1 网络配置错误 网络配置是连接物理机与虚拟机的桥梁
如果VMware的网络适配器设置不正确,或者子网掩码、网关等关键参数配置有误,将导致两者之间的通信受阻
此外,物理机的网络设置也可能影响与虚拟网络的连接,如IP地址冲突、DNS解析问题等
2.2 防火墙与安全组策略 防火墙和安全组策略是保护网络安全的重要防线,但也可能成为通信障碍
如果物理机或虚拟机的防火墙规则过于严格,或者安全组策略未正确配置以允许特定端口的通信,将导致真机无法访问VMware网络
2.3 路由问题 路由是数据包在网络中传输的路径指引
如果物理网络与虚拟网络之间的路由设置不正确,或者存在路由环路、路由黑洞等问题,将导致数据包无法正确到达目的地
2.4 VMware工具缺失或异常 VMware工具是一组增强虚拟机性能和管理功能的软件包,其中包括网络适配器驱动程序
如果虚拟机未安装VMware工具,或者VMware工具运行异常,将影响虚拟机的网络通信能力
2.5 虚拟机网络模式选择不当 VMware提供了多种虚拟机网络模式,如桥接模式、NAT模式、仅主机模式等
不同的网络模式适用于不同的应用场景
如果选择了不适合当前需求的网络模式,将导致网络通信问题
三、解决方案 3.1 检查并修正网络配置 首先,应检查物理机和虚拟机的网络配置,确保IP地址、子网掩码、网关等参数设置正确且无误
同时,确认DNS服务器设置正确,以便正确解析域名
对于VMware的网络适配器,应确保其配置与物理网络环境相匹配
3.2 调整防火墙与安全组策略 检查物理机和虚拟机的防火墙设置,确保必要的端口和协议已开放
对于安全组策略,应根据业务需求进行适当配置,以允许真机与虚拟机之间的通信
在调整防火墙和安全组策略时,务必谨慎操作,避免引入新的安全风险
3.3 优化路由设置 针对路由问题,应检查物理网络与虚拟网络之间的路由配置,确保路由路径正确且无误
如果存在路由环路或路由黑洞等问题,应及时进行调整和优化
此外,还可以考虑使用静态路由或动态路由协议来增强网络的灵活性和可靠性
3.4 安装或更新VMware工具 对于未安装VMware工具的虚拟机,应立即进行安装
对于已安装但运行异常的VMware工具,应尝试更新到最新版本或重新安装
在安装或更新VMware工具时,应确保其与VMware服务器的版本兼容
3.5 选择合适的虚拟机网络模式 根据业务需求选择合适的虚拟机网络模式
例如,如果需要在物理网络和虚拟机网络之间实现无缝通信,可以选择桥接模式;如果需要为虚拟机提供独立的IP地址空间并保护其免受外部攻击,可以选择NAT模式;如果仅需要在虚拟机之间进行通信而无需访问外部网络,可以选择仅主机模式
四、预防措施与最佳实践 为了避免真机无法访问VMware网络的问题再次发生,建议采取以下预防措施和最佳实践: 1.定期备份网络配置:定期备份物理机和虚拟机的网络配置,以便在出现问题时能够迅速恢复
2.监控网络状态:使用网络监控工具实时监控物理网络和虚拟网络的状态,及时发现并解决潜在问题
3.定期更新软件:定期更新VMware服务器、虚拟机操作系统和VMware工具等软件,以确保其安全性和稳定性
4.培训与支持:对IT团队进行定期的培训和支持,提高他们的技术水平和解决问题的能力
5.制定应急计划:制定详细的应急计划,包括问题定位、解决方案和恢复步骤等,以便在问题发生时能够迅速响应并恢复服务
五、结论 真机无法访问VMware网络的问题是一个复杂且常见的挑战,但通过仔细分析问题的根源并采取适当的解决方案,我们可以有效地解决这一问题
本文提供了从问题剖析到解决方案的完整框架,旨在帮助IT人员快速定位问题并采取有效措施
同时,通过采取预防措施和最佳实践,我们可以进一步降低类似问题的发生概率,确保虚拟化环境的稳定性和可靠性
在未来的工作中,我们将继续关注虚拟化技术的发展趋势和新的挑战,为企业的信息化建设提供更加全面和高效的支持